Why do I snort?

When the air is forced through an obstructed area, soft tissues in the mouth, nose and throat bump into each other and vibrate. The vibrations make a rattling, snorting or grumbling sound. Snoring can interrupt sleep.

Why do you wheeze when you laugh?

This squeezes air out of us, and makes a noise – each ‘ha ha ha’ in a laugh reflects one of these contractions. We don’t do much else to shape the noise of laughter – it’s a very basic way of making a sound. When these contractions start to run into one another, people just start to make wheezing sounds.

Why do I cough every time I laugh?

The nerves that are involved in the laughing reflex are the same nerves that are involved in the Coughing reflex. Therefore, triggering the laughing reflex can also trigger the Coughing reflex. The laughing and Coughing sequence is common.

What is behind tongue?

The epiglottis is a leaf-shaped flap of cartilage tissue that lies just behind the back of your tongue. When you swallow, your epiglottis covers your voice box (larynx) stopping food from entering your windpipe (trachea).

What causes snoring in females?

Snoring can be caused by a number of things, like oral anatomy, sinus anatomy, allergies, a cold, the person’s weight, or even a jaw joint disorder. When a person sleeps, the muscles in the mouth, tongue, and throat relax, and this exacerbates the aforementioned issues to cause snoring.
